Delhi govt not involved in Ravidas temple razing, says Arvind Kejriwal

Mayawati asked both the governments to pay for the construction of a new temple

On Wednesday, Delhi Chief Minister Arvind Kejriwal while expressing his upsetness said that his government is not involved in the razing of saint Ravidas temple. Arvind Kejriwal's reaction comes after former Uttar Pradesh CM and BSP chief Mayawati said that the Central and Delhi governments were both involved in the demolition of the temple which took place in Tughlakabad.
